AngioDynamics EVP and CFO Stephen A. Trowbridge received equity awards on July 15, 2026. He was granted 53,257 restricted stock units, vesting in four equal annual installments each July 15 from 2027 through 2030, and 53,257 performance rights, each a contingent right to one share of common stock. Payout on the performance rights can range from 0% up to 240% of the target, based on relative total shareholder return over a three-year performance period. After the restricted stock unit award, his directly held common stock reported in this line totals 297,819 shares.

Footnotes (2)
  1. F1. The acquisition of 53,257 shares of common stock ("Common Stock") of AngioDynamics, Inc. represents 53,257 restricted stock units, each of which represents a contingent right to receive one share of Common Stock. These restricted stock units vest in four equal annual installments beginning on July 15, 2027, such that 25% of the restricted stock units will vest on each of July 15, 2027, 2028, 2029 and 2030.
  2. F2. Each performance right represents a contingent right to receive one share of Common Stock. The target number of shares of Common Stock is set forth in columns 5 and 7 of Table II. Between 0% and 200% of the target number will be earned based on total shareholder return relative to a peer group of companies over a three-year performance period (with a potential upward or downward 20% adjustment on the calculated achievement based on total shareholder return relative to a peer group of companies over a three-year performance period (for a total potential payout of up to 240% of the target number in the aggregate)) in accordance with performance metrics as determined by the compensation committee. Any shares that do not vest at the end of the performance period will be forfeited.

Total shareholder return is the overall gain an investor gets from owning a stock, combining changes in the share price plus any cash payouts like dividends, and assuming those payouts are reinvested in more shares. Investors use it like a single score that shows the true return on their investment—similar to checking both the growth of a savings account and the interest earned—to compare how well different companies or investments perform over time.
